Frequently asked questions

What is a business financial strategy consultant?

A business financial strategy consultant helps growth-stage businesses build long-term financial plans — covering capital allocation, profitability architecture, funding structure, and financial systems — aligned with where the business is trying to go over the next 3–5 years.

How is business financial strategy different from cash flow advisory?

Cash flow advisory focuses on diagnosing and fixing immediate cash flow problems — working capital, debtor cycles, and profit-to-cash conversion. Business financial strategy is the longer-term layer: where to deploy capital, how to build profitability, and how to structure the business financially for sustained growth and value creation.
